Texas Eats
Whatever enticements bring you to the great land of Texas, I can guarantee you one thing, the food is what will keep you there. The South has perfected their own unique standard of cuisine, and the Lone Star State is saturated with it. The delicacies and delights found here are quite lacking anywhere else in the world.
It’s easy to spell fun in Texas — BBQ. Despite the population, the biggest cities and the smallest towns all have their own barbecue establishment of some kind. Each self proclaiming themselves, no doubt, to be “The Best Barbecue in Texas!” With only slight variations, you can easily expect an atmosphere of brushed steel, wood planks, hickory smoke, and country music.
But since you are only there for the food, you should know that there exists any choice of beef, pork, or chicken. No matter where you go for your experience, you can expect the variation of a spicy kick, a sweet honey glaze, or a classic hickory smoked saturation to fit your preference. When I first came to Texas, it came as quite a surprise to find at even the most elegant of events a banquet arrayed in barbecue.
The barbecue succeeds due to the excess of Texas’ most precious asset of beef. Driving through the state it is not rare to see land roaming for miles with the most beautiful livestock. The great land spanning these acres feeds the most delicious animals in the state.
If you don’t prefer to have your animals barbecued, surely you couldn’t resist a melting piece of tender steak in your mouth. Fine Texas Steakhouses are hard to miss around the state as well. I would suggest a medium grill to your choice of cut in order to achieve the most tender and yet sufficiently cooked dinner delight.
Texas also has a lucky connection so close to the border which has given birth to a fascinating genre of food that only exists here as TexMex. The further south you travel, perhaps to San Antonio at least, the hispanic culture has authentically romanticized the food here. Warm tortillas, fresh salsa, and explosive flavors lull us away in this perfect union of Mexican style food made by the Texan grown culture.
All the acres of land that makes Texas proud gives fruit to unending varieties of succulent produce. Undoubtedly my favorite is, the peach. You can’t find a better peach cobbler than in the South, for good reason.
Peaches thrive in this climate and humidity. In our own backyard we grow a large fruitful peach tree that satisfies our craving for juicy sweet peaches with each summer season. Everyone in our community also looks forward to this season for my family to bring over paper bags full of peaches to share.
The land and humidity here in Texas are not always so unbearable. They bring forth the great fruits of quite enjoyable eating. Livestock, fruits, and vegetables all have a happy home grown in Texas. Any traveller will gorge with substantial delight in any of the unique culinary creations that all Texans should be proud of.

Tips and Tricks for Choosing Top Culinary Schools
The culinary school industry has been flourishing in recent years and this makes it easy to find one that is not far from home. Nonetheless, when choosing a top culinary school, try not to be restrained by only choosing ones that are close to home. There are many culinary schools available, take your time to compare and research each of them.
The admission process into any culinary school has been made easier in recent years, making professional studies within reach of many. A good culinary school usually comprises of several major divisions including cooking faculty, restaurant management, hotel management as well as patisseries and baking. An understanding of these faculties helps individuals choose the specialty areas for their future careers.
Culinary schools tend to be fairly pricey establishments to maintain. This is due to a need to adhere to safety standards in each state and country, which means they need to have a small ratio between number of students and teaching chefs. On top of that, their equipments and practical classes (kitchen) need to be in tip top conditions and insurance is a must for culinary schools. These are some of the criteria that the culinary school must meet to get accredited.
Accreditation is a vital factor in choosing culinary schools. It is a quality assurance that the programs offered are of quality standard. Each culinary school needs to meet a certain level of requirements before they can be accredited. An accredited program can also provide you with additional services such as financial help, scholarships and much more.
An important thing to consider when deciding your culinary school is your own goals. There are a lot of programs on offer these days. They can range from short culinary courses to bachelors degrees which can take up to four years. If you are clear on which level of education you are seeking, this makes it easier to narrow down to a few suitable culinary schools. It is always good to know what to expect from a culinary school. A good culinary arts course should offer you training to succeed as a culinary chef and understanding various business or leadership styles. On top of that, skills such as catering management, restaurant management, accounting, finance and stock handling will also be part of the curriculum.
Keep in mind that a culinary arts degree can offer you a chance of a lifetime. You can choose to go into hotel management, catering, chef and many more job opportunities from there. The work opportunities are endless as culinary arts graduate can work in many settings and be successful in them.
Finally, before enrolling in any courses, ask yourself why had you chosen to pursue a career in culinary arts? Once you are certain that this is the course you want to take, you can then pour your heart and soul into learning the language of culinary arts.
